Green Living Expo Coming November 6-Exhibitors Sought

The 3rd annual Bioneers Conference & free Green Living Expo is seeking exhibitors for their Nov. 6 event. Green organizations and businesses who are interested in exhibiting at the conference must register by Sept. 30 to be listed on the Bioneers and Lou Marchi Total Recycling Institute websites.

The Bioneers Conference and free Green Living Expo will provide green information everyone can use to make their life greener through innovation from 8:30 a.m. to 4:30 p.m. Saturday, Nov. 6 in the college’s conference center and commons area in Building B, 8900 U.S. Hwy. 14 in Crystal Lake, Illinois. Free Green Living Expo is open from 10 a.m. to 4 p.m.
Presented by the Lou Marchi Total Recycling Institute at McHenry County College, the MCC Conference Center and the Culinary Management Program at MCC, this event will feature Jim Braun, coordinator of Illinois Local Food, Farms and Jobs Council, who will present a keynote address titled, “Food: How It’s All Connected.” Morning and Afternoon breakout sessions facilitated by regional experts will follow his talk. Session topics include: healthy food and schools, growing and preserving food, developing local food possibilities, energy efficiency resources for homes and businesses, greening of the faith community, and climate change. Also, Bioneers will include sessions from the 2010 national Bioneers Conference on DVD featuring leading environmental experts on “hot topics.”

Major sponsor for the conference is Woodstock Farmer’s Market with Duke’s Alehouse and Kitchen as a co-sponsor of the event.

“The Bioneers Conference and free Green Living Expo is an opportunity to inform McHenry County residents, businesses and local agencies about the green businesses and organizations in their own backyard and to inform them about the positive impact these groups can have on their lives,” said Pat Dieckhoff, waste reduction assistant for the Lou Marchi Total Recycling Institute at MCC.
